Understanding the Farm Equipment Market: Buying & Selling
Navigating the rural machinery market, whether you’re acquiring or selling, can feel like a maze. Knowing the state of affairs is essential for a good deal. Prices fluctuate based on multiple influences, including crop values, interest rates, and the business environment. Think about the history of the implement; newer models usually command higher prices, but well-maintained older equipment can be a smart investment.
- Research: Thoroughly investigate sales data.
- Inspection: Scrutinize the equipment before you buy.
- Negotiation: Be prepared to back-and-forth.
